When it comes to designing user interfaces, every detail counts, especially how we position icons over dropdown selectors. It can significantly enhance user experience, making navigation intuitive and visually appealing. In this post, we will explore effective techniques to position icons over dropdown selectors, share helpful tips and shortcuts, and discuss common mistakes to avoid.
Understanding Dropdown Selectors and Icons
Dropdown selectors are an essential part of many web forms, offering users a way to select an option from a list without cluttering the interface. ๐ Adding icons can elevate these selectors by providing visual cues about the options, ultimately leading to a more user-friendly experience.
Why Positioning Icons Matters
The correct positioning of icons can:
- Improve readability ๐: Users quickly understand the action associated with the dropdown.
- Enhance aesthetics: Icons can make your interface more visually appealing.
- Provide context: Helps users grasp the function of dropdowns without reading every word.
Best Practices for Positioning Icons
Here are some strategies to effectively position icons over dropdown selectors:
1. Align Icons with Text
Position your icons either to the left or right of the dropdown text. This alignment keeps the visual flow of the dropdown intact.
Example: If you're using a dropdown for selecting a country, a small globe icon can be placed to the left of the text.
2. Use Consistent Icon Sizes
All icons used with dropdowns should have a consistent size. This consistency ensures that dropdowns look uniform and well-integrated.
Icon Size Options | Recommended Size |
---|---|
Small | 16px x 16px |
Medium | 24px x 24px |
Large | 32px x 32px |
3. Maintain Adequate Spacing
Leave some space between the icon and the dropdown text to avoid visual clutter. A good rule of thumb is to provide a margin of 5-10 pixels.
4. Consider Icon Color
Make sure your icon's color contrasts well with both the dropdown background and the font. This contrast ensures that the icon is easily visible, even in low light.
Common Mistakes to Avoid
- Overcrowding the Dropdown: Adding too many icons or too large icons can overwhelm users. Stick to one well-chosen icon per dropdown.
- Using Similar Icons: If your dropdowns feature icons that are too similar, it can confuse users. Ensure each icon is distinct.
- Ignoring Accessibility: Consider users with visual impairments. Make sure the icons are discernible and provide alternative text for screen readers.
Troubleshooting Issues
If users are having trouble with dropdown icons, here are some quick troubleshooting tips:
- Test Different Devices: Ensure your icons render well across various devices. What looks good on a desktop may not translate well to a mobile view.
- Gather User Feedback: Regularly request input from users on the usability of the dropdowns.
- Adjust Icon Placement: If users miss the icon, try relocating it slightly. Small adjustments can make a big difference!
Helpful Tips and Advanced Techniques
1. Use Tooltips for Additional Information
If the icon's function might not be clear, consider using tooltips. When users hover over an icon, a small box can appear, giving them more context.
2. Enable Keyboard Navigation
Make sure that dropdowns can be accessed using keyboard shortcuts. This is an essential aspect of accessibility and enhances user experience for everyone.
3. Utilize CSS for Smooth Transitions
Using CSS transitions can make the dropdown feel more alive. A subtle fade-in effect when the dropdown opens can create a smooth and satisfying interaction.
4. A/B Testing
Conduct A/B tests to determine which icon placements yield the best user engagement. Testing can help you optimize layouts effectively.
<div class="faq-section"> <div class="faq-container"> <h2>Frequently Asked Questions</h2> <div class="faq-item"> <div class="faq-question"> <h3>What icons should I use for dropdown selectors?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Choose icons that clearly represent the action or category of the dropdown. Common examples include arrows for selection, a magnifying glass for search options, and globe icons for geographic selections.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>How can I test the effectiveness of my icon placements?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Conduct usability tests with real users. Observe how they interact with the dropdowns and gather feedback on their experience. You can also use analytics tools to track user engagement.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>Are there specific colors I should use for dropdown icons?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Choose colors that contrast well with the dropdown background and text. Itโs essential to ensure good visibility, especially for users with color vision deficiencies.</p> </div> </div> </div> </div>
Conclusion
Positioning icons over dropdown selectors effectively is an art that can greatly enhance the overall user experience. By following the best practices we've discussed, you can create visually appealing and functional interfaces that guide users intuitively through your application. Don't forget to experiment, gather feedback, and continuously improve your designs!
Remember to practice these techniques as you delve deeper into your design projects. Explore other related tutorials in this blog to expand your skills and knowledge further.
<p class="pro-note">๐Pro Tip: Keep refining your designs based on user feedback to ensure they remain intuitive and user-friendly!</p>